Roofing Evaluation



Routinely evaluating your roof covering is crucial to guaranteeing it can hold up against the severe wintertime weather condition in advance. Start by looking for any missing out on, harmed, or crinkling tiles. These could cause leakages or more damages during winter season storms. Keep an eye out for any type of indicators of water damage or mold and mildew, as these might indicate a larger issue with your roof's honesty. It's additionally essential to evaluate the seamless gutters and downspouts for particles or blockages that can create water to support and possibly harm your roof covering.

Throughout your inspection, pay attention to any areas where water may pool or gather, as this can compromise the roof covering's structure in time. Seek any kind of indications of drooping or dips in the roofline, as these can show underlying concerns that need to be addressed before winter months sets in.

Debris Removal



When it pertains to preparing your roofing system for winter season, one necessary task is clearing away particles that could cause possible problems. Beginning by removing leaves, branches, and any other debris that has gathered on your roof covering. These things can catch dampness, producing a breeding ground for mold and mold, which can damage your roofing system with time. Utilize a durable ladder to access your roofing safely, and a mop or fallen leave blower to sweep the particles.

Pay unique focus to the valleys and rain gutters where particles often tends to collect one of the most.

Insulation Examine



A correct insulation check is essential in preparing your roof covering for winter season. Prior to the winter embed in, put in the time to evaluate the insulation in your attic or roofing room.

Begin by looking for any indicators of wetness or mold and mildew growth, as these can indicate concerns with your insulation. Look for locations where the insulation might be pressed, damp, or missing entirely. Appropriate insulation aids control the temperature in your house, protects against heat loss, and minimizes energy prices throughout the cold weather.
